## Local Setup — Bounceworks Processor

The Bounceworks service consumes bounce notifications from the Mallard queue, classifies them (hard, soft, suppressed), and writes results to the local suppression database. Before first run, apply migrations with `bw migrate up` and seed classification rules via `bw seed-rules`. The processor will refuse to start if the suppression schema is missing. Point it at your local database instance using the connection string below.

replica DSN, kajep-yahag: mssql://praok_svc:iF@db-8d68.plorvaio.local:5432/eliion

### Step 4: Reconfigure the Receipt Mailer

After migrating the donor database, point the Givewell-style mailer, Thistledown Receipts, at the new queue. Old receipt jobs will not replay automatically; re-enqueue anything from the cut-over window manually. Templates carry over unchanged, but currency formatting now comes from the locale service. Set the service configuration to the following values.

config for kajog-tadug:
[casax]
port = 11211
region = west-3
host = casax.nelvroworks.internal
timeout_ms = 5000
retries = 7

- [ ] Step 7: Archive cold storage buckets (Glacierline tier). Confirm both ceremony witnesses are present, verify bucket manifests match the Oxbow ledger, then seal the archive key shares. Plugin authors may observe but not handle shares. Once sealed, the archive index itself is encrypted and can only be reopened with the passphrase below.

vault phrase of badup-hahig = tamael-aldael-kelmir-istael-fenok-istwyn-tamius-jorath-oliion